The TDM-1 series temperature transmitter is designed for gas and liquid measurement in a variety of industrial applications.  Its modular compact design offers a unique combination of high measurement performance, flexible configuration and a robust stainless steel design.


Temperature sensor technology

Traditional temperature measurement is based on thermistor, thermocouple or RTD sensors. The TDM-1 is based on semiconductor diode junction sensor technology. The sensor technology offers high measurement accuracy and repeatability in combination with a fast response to temperature changes.   

The novel dual sensor probe design offers two individually calibrated sensors for improved measurement stability and redundancy in critical applications.


Measurement performance

Each product is individually tested and calibrated to comply to DIN 60751 class AA accuracy. The calibration sheet is supplied with the product and is also stored electronically in the product’s internal memory.


Advanced enclosure design

The IP67 sealed 316 stainless steel enclosure with integrated hydrophobic membrane is designed for extreme environments. The innovative moisture control barrier prevents internal moisture accumulation and water condensation when changes in ambient pressure, temperature and humidity occur.


S4-Connect™

The innovative S4-Connect™ USB digital communication interface provides access to the powerful digital core. It enables digital communication over the power supply line, thus eliminating the need for additional connector pins. The interface can be used for diagnostics, maintenance, service, calibration, setpoint configuration and setting of other customized parameters. Furthermore, the products offer pin compatibility with industry standard pin-outs for analog transducers.

Process temperature control

The optional setpoint can either be used for controlling or surveillance of the measured temperature via a solid-state relay. The basic control uses on/off regulation whereas the advanced option utilizes a programable built-in PID regulator. The built-in PID regulator can eliminate the need for a traditional external PID controller in OEM equipment where PID parameters are static. 


Analog and digital options 

The TDM-1 is available in versions with traditional analog output (e.g. 4-20 mA and 0-10 VDC) and various optional digital interfaces. Advantages by using digital communication include more noise-robust measurements and user-configurable settings such as relay switching, output scaling, etc. The industry standard IO-Link interface offers easy integration in industrial applications. The USB interface is a plug-and-play solution for standalone PC test systems.
